Spouting Off, Part 2: Dynamic vs. Transactional Engineers

The study I mentioned in my previous post contains a subtopic worth discussing: Classifying Engineers. The study classifies two types of engineers: dynamic and transactional. The qualities of each are as follows.

Dynamic engineers:Transactional engineers:These lists provide some good guidelines for assessing how engineers fare competitively. In order to remain competitive, engineers should consider where we lie on the scale between Transactional and Dynamic and continuously progress toward a more Dynamic position. In an effort to become more dyanamic, engineers should seek opportunities to expand our breadth of capabilities or improve upon specific ones. Ideally we'll do both.
